Observation Details
Initial observations: hard wind crust underfoot, cracking around feet but no shooting cracks or wumphing.
Finger hardness test: mostly hard over soft snow. 4 finger/1 finger hardness consistently throughout most of the pit.
ECT test: The pit was 75 cm deep, down to rotted facet/ice flow layer on the ground. Found a crust at about 40cm. ECT 24, nonplanar shear with no propagation, fracture at 40cm.
Skiing was wind crust with some harder crusts but consistently pleasant skiing.
